What is Boursin Cheese?

The History of Boursin Cheese

Boursin cheese originated in France in 1957, created by François Boursin, a cheesemaker from Normandy. Inspired by a traditional French recipe of mixing soft cheese with herbs, he developed a creamy, spreadable cheese with a rich garlic and herb flavor. It quickly gained popularity and became a staple in gourmet and home kitchens worldwide.

Ingredients and Texture of Boursin Cheese

Boursin cheese is known for its smooth, creamy texture and bold, garlicky taste. The most popular variety, Garlic & Fine Herbs, contains:

  • Fresh cream and soft cheese
  • Garlic
  • Parsley
  • Chives
  • Salt and pepper

Its airy consistency makes it easy to spread, melt, or mix into dishes for an instant flavor boost.

Boursin Stuffed Mushrooms

These bite-sized mushrooms are creamy, cheesy, and bursting with garlic-herb flavor.

Ingredients:

  • 12 large mushrooms
  • 1 package (150g) Boursin Garlic & Fine Herbs
  • ½ cup breadcrumbs
  • 2 tbsp Parmesan cheese
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 tsp chopped parsley

Instructions:

  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Remove stems from mushrooms and hollow out the caps.
  3. In a bowl, mix Boursin cheese, breadcrumbs, Parmesan, and olive oil.
  4. Stuff each mushroom cap with the mixture and place on a baking sheet.
  5. Bake for 15-18 minutes until golden brown.
  6. Garnish with parsley and serve warm.

🧀 Tip: Add crushed red pepper for a little spice!

Boursin Cheese Dip with Crackers and Veggies

A creamy, tangy dip that’s perfect for parties or a quick snack.

Ingredients:

  • 1 package (150g) Boursin Garlic & Fine Herbs
  • ½ cup sour cream
  • ½ cup mayonnaise
  • 1 tsp lemon juice
  • 1 tbsp chopped chives

Instructions:

  1. In a bowl, mix Boursin cheese, sour cream, mayonnaise, and lemon juice.
  2. Stir until smooth.
  3. Sprinkle with chives and serve with crackers, carrots, or celery.

😋 Pro Tip: Add a drizzle of honey for a sweet contrast!

Creamy Boursin Pasta

This velvety pasta dish is quick, easy, and full of garlicky goodness.

Ingredients:

  • 12 oz pasta (fettuccine or penne)
  • 1 package (150g) Boursin Garlic & Fine Herbs
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• ½ cup grated Parmesan
  • 2 tbsp butter
  • 1 clove garlic, minced
  • 1 tsp black pepper
  • Fresh parsley for garnish

Instructions:

  1. Cook pasta according to package instructions. Drain and set aside.
  2. In a pan, melt butter and sauté garlic for 1 minute.
  3. Add heavy cream and Boursin cheese, stirring until smooth.
  4. Toss in pasta, Parmesan, and black pepper.
  5. Serve hot, garnished with parsley.

🍝 Want protein? Add grilled chicken or shrimp for an extra boost!

Boursin-Stuffed Chicken Breast

Juicy, cheesy, and full of rich flavors—this dish is a must-try!

Ingredients:

  • 2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 1 package (150g) Boursin Garlic & Fine Herbs
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• ½ tsp salt
  • ½ tsp black pepper
  • ½ tsp paprika

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Slice a pocket into each chicken breast.
  3. Stuff each pocket with Boursin cheese.
  4. Brush with olive oil and season with salt, pepper, and paprika.
  5. Bake for 25-30 minutes until golden brown.

🔥 Tip: Serve with mashed potatoes or steamed asparagus!

Boursin Cheese and Spinach Stuffed Salmon

A rich and flavorful salmon dish with a creamy, herby twist.

Ingredients:

  • 2 salmon fillets
  • ½ package (75g) Boursin Garlic & Fine Herbs
  • ½ cup fresh spinach, chopped
  • 1 tsp lemon zest
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• ½ tsp salt
  • ½ tsp black pepper

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Slice a pocket in each salmon fillet.
  3. In a bowl, mix Boursin cheese, spinach, and lemon zest.
  4. Stuff the mixture into the salmon pockets.
  5. Drizzle with olive oil, sprinkle with salt and pepper.
  6. Bake for 12-15 minutes until flaky.

🐟 Tip: Serve with garlic butter asparagus or a side salad for a complete meal!

Boursin Mashed Potatoes

Creamy, cheesy mashed potatoes that melt in your mouth!

Ingredients:

  • 4 large potatoes, peeled and cubed
  • 1 package (150g) Boursin Garlic & Fine Herbs
  • ½ cup heavy cream
  • 2 tbsp butter
  • ½ tsp salt
  • ½ tsp black pepper

Instructions:

  1. Boil potatoes until fork-tender (about 15 minutes).
  2. Drain and mash with a potato masher.
  3. Add Boursin cheese, butter, heavy cream, salt, and pepper.
  4. Stir until smooth and creamy.

🥔 Pro Tip: Sprinkle with fresh chives or crispy bacon bits for extra flavor!

Boursin Roasted Vegetables

A simple, delicious way to upgrade your veggies!

Ingredients:

  • 2 cups mixed vegetables (carrots, bell peppers, zucchini)
  • 1 package (150g) Boursin Garlic & Fine Herbs
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 tsp dried oregano
  • ½ tsp salt
  • ½ tsp black pepper

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 425°F (220°C).
  2. Toss veggies with olive oil, salt, pepper, and oregano.
  3. Roast for 20 minutes, stirring halfway through.
  4. While hot, toss with crumbled Boursin cheese.

🌿 Tip: Use sweet potatoes or Brussels sprouts for variety!

Boursin Cheese and Herb Biscuits

Fluffy, cheesy, and perfect for breakfast or dinner!

Ingredients:

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tbsp baking powder
  • ½ tsp salt
  • ½ cup butter, cold and cubed
  • 1 package (150g) Boursin Garlic & Fine Herbs
  • ½ cup milk

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Mix flour, baking powder, and salt.
  3. Cut in butter until the mixture resembles crumbs.
  4. Fold in Boursin cheese and milk.
  5. Drop spoonfuls onto a baking sheet and bake for 12-15 minutes.

🍞 Serve with: Butter, honey, or a drizzle of garlic aioli!

Boursin Mac and Cheese

A creamy, dreamy twist on a classic comfort food.

Ingredients:

  • 12 oz elbow macaroni
  • 1 package (150g) Boursin Garlic & Fine Herbs
  • 2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
  • 2 cups milk
  • 2 tbsp butter
  • 1 tsp black pepper

Instructions:

  1. Cook macaroni according to package directions; drain.
  2. In a pot, melt butter, then add milk and cheeses.
  3. Stir until smooth, then toss in pasta and coat well.

🧀 Tip: Top with breadcrumbs and bake for 10 minutes for extra crunch!

Boursin Cheese Pizza with Caramelized Onions

A gourmet pizza with a rich, creamy base.

Ingredients:

  • 1 pizza crust
  • ½ package (75g) Boursin Garlic & Fine Herbs
  • 1 cup mozzarella cheese
  • 1 large onion, caramelized
  • ½ cup mushrooms, sliced
  • 1 tbsp olive oil

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 425°F (220°C).
  2. Spread Boursin cheese on the pizza crust.
  3. Add caramelized onions, mushrooms, and mozzarella.
  4. Drizzle with olive oil and bake for 12-15 minutes.

🍕 Pro Tip: Add arugula and balsamic glaze for an extra gourmet touch!

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Can I make homemade Boursin cheese?

Yes! Mix cream cheese, butter, garlic, and herbs to create a homemade version.

What’s the best way to store Boursin cheese?

Keep it in the fridge, sealed, and consume within two weeks for freshness.

Can Boursin cheese be frozen?

Technically yes, but the texture may become grainy. Best to use it fresh!

Is Boursin cheese healthy?

It’s rich in calcium and protein but also high in fat. Enjoy in moderation!

What are some dairy-free alternatives to Boursin cheese?

Try cashew-based spreads or almond ricotta mixed with garlic and herbs!
